Here are some that I can remember
AAMOF as a matter of fact
BBFN bye bye for now
BFN bye for now
BTW by the way
BYKT but you knew that
CMIIW correct me if I'm wrong
EOL end of lecture
FWIW for what it's worth
FYI for your information
HTH hope this helps
IAC in any case
IAE in any event
IMHO in my humble opinion
IMNSHO in my not so humble opinion
IOW in other words
KOTC kiss on the cheek
LOL lots of luck or laughing out loud
MGB may God bless
NRN no reply necessary
OIC oh, I see
OTOH on the other hand
ROTFLMAOrolling on the floor laughing my *** off
RSN real soon now
SITD still in the dark
TIA thanks in advance
TIC tongue in cheek
TTYL talk to you later
TYVM thank you very much
That's all I can remember for now, but sometimes I just make them up as I go along. IYDM (if you don't mind)
